Cheap dishes!! Spring rolls $40. Beef noodles $35. Pork neck cold noodles $35. Decent portions for the price. Will be back to try others.
Good cheap food. $30 for a bowl of pho . I tried the pork yellow curry noodles ($38). So delicious. Small Seafood Tom Yum Gong ($58) was hearty and just the right spices!
Good, cheap Thai and Vietnamese food but positively awful service. Tasty Thai green curry and completely serviceable beef pho . Hope you're cool with getting the stink eye for your entire meal.
Between thai, vietnamese and chinese and not much taste especially the pad thai . Would not recommend...
